BottleTaps is Pleasanton’s premiere Taproom and Bottleshop with 30 taps and over 200 selections in the cooler including beer, cider, mead, kombucha, and craft sodas. Our executive chef Andre Muller cooks up high end tapas and sharable plates that pair perfectly with our extensive beer selections. There are also full meal options for larger appetites.
